Output 768db4cd4aec5a0d0b98318b882f96a94b7d50d45a4a77cfe46269aba8c59a3f:0

value
605682
script pubkey
OP_0 OP_PUSHBYTES_20 bbf0aceb7d5153a07ef822f862635e4dfb89c3e5
address
ltc1qh0c2e6ma29f6qlhcytuxyc67fhacnsl9exxlrc
transaction
768db4cd4aec5a0d0b98318b882f96a94b7d50d45a4a77cfe46269aba8c59a3f
spent
true